Honjin Sushi Japanese Restaurant (Yaletown)

Honjin Sushi Japanese Restaurant (dinehere.ca link, 138 Davie Street, phone (604) 688-8808) is a popular place in Vancouver’s downtown Yaletown neighborhood for excellent sushi, teriyaki, tempura, and other delicious Japanese items. It’s located near False Creek in the same complex as the Roundhouse community centre. The menu is a-la-carte, large, and varied, with a wide selection of everything from ebi gyoza (dumpling with prawn, $9.50), to the assorted sashimi (pictured below, $11.95), and the assorted sushi (pictured below at bottom, $10.95). If you’re feeling adventurous, be sure to try one of their specialty rolls such as the Sunshine Roll (which is topped with mango), or the Yaletown Maki (a prawn tempura roll wrapped with sliced raw seafood).

Sonomama Japanese Restaurant (Granville St)

Sonomama Japanese Restaurant (web site, 980 Granville St., Vancouver, phone 604-662-3770) is a relatively new addition to downtown’s Granville Street strip, amidst the nightclubs and fast food restaurants near the corner of Granville and Nelson. A lot of care has obviously gone into the design and decor of this restaurant: it’s an ultra-modern and stylish room with huge vaulted ceilings, a glowing wrap-around sushi bar, tables and a few comfortable booths. For best value, be sure to try items from the combination menu, such as one of the sushi combinations ($10 to $13) or the Chirashi and Udon combo ($12.95). Chirashi-don (pictured below) is a bowl filled with rice and topped with fresh seafood, and the combo also came with a bowl of hot udon-noodle soup.

Update (Jan 1, 2008): Sonomama has closed and there is a new Indian restaurant there now.

Samurai Japanese Restaurant (Davie St)

Samurai Japanese Restaurant (more photos, 1108 Davie St. Vancouver, Phone 604-609-0078) is a cozy and very busy restaurant located in Vancouver’s downtown core. It serves yummy Japanese food at reasonable prices. My “Combination C” came with a variety of sushi and sashimi (pictured below) as well as Teriyaki, Tempura, miso soup, and rice. My meal came to $13.73 including tax.
